Octopus Energy is a UK‑based renewable electricity supplier that leverages AI, data analytics, and a cloud‑native platform to offer dynamic, transparent pricing and smart‑grid solutions. Its open‑source API ecosystem and commitment to carbon neutrality have earned it recognition as a tech‑driven pioneer in the energy sector.

Open roles span software engineering, data science, DevOps, cloud architecture, product management, and UX design. Teams work in agile sprints, often remotely, and receive equity, continuous learning stipends, and a culture that rewards experimentation.
